Industrial Manufacturing Companies: Offshore vs Nearshore

off shore manufacturing

You may be familiar with the idea of “offshore manufacturing”, where in companies save money by manufacturing goods outside of the country where labor and material costs may be cheaper. Many developed countries are used to importing goods from China, for example.

However, recent supply chain issues, rising shipping costs, and concerns around intellectual property security have left many US companies searching for an alternative. Enter: nearshore manufacturing.

Nearshore manufacturing is when a business expands manufacturing to a nearby country, usually sharing a border with the business’s home country. This allows for better communication through shared language and similar time zones, lower shipping costs, more beneficial trade agreements, and greater security around intellectual property, all while still enjoying a lower manufacturing cost.
